Abstract: Collection consists of newspaper
clippings, government publications, reports, a map, and other documents related to the Los
Angeles Aqueduct and conflict with Owens Valley residents. Papers represent the voices of
Los Angeles County government officials, disgruntled Owens Valley residents, engineers, and
individuals writing about the Los Angeles Aqueduct. Materials detail the water battle
between Owens Valley residents and Los Angeles officials through newspapers, propaganda, and
other publications. Also included are later publications on the environmental impact of the
Los Angeles Aqueduct as well as written histories of the Owens Valley project and Los
Angeles Aqueduct.

Scope and Content of the Collection
Materials consist of a multitude of newspaper sources from the Los Angeles and Owens Valley
region. Collection also includes government reports from the Los Angeles Department of Water
and Power, propaganda, and published papers from committees supporting Owens Valley
residents and the region. Includes association reports such as those from the Association of
American Portland Cement Manufacturers and American Society of Civil Engineers as well as a
map of the Owens Valley region by the United States Geological Survey. Travel brochures
created by the Los Angeles Department of Water and Power, magazine articles, a typewritten
correspondence, a speech, and other materials tell of the Los Angeles Aqueduct's
construction and value as well as its impact on Owens Valley residents.
